The Malta National Aquarium is the largest aquarium in the Maltese Islands. It is located in Qawra, in the northern part of the island of Malta, and it hosts more than 175 different species of various animals, including fish, mollusca, reptiles and insects.

The aquarium is not big, only indoors but it was much more interesting than expected. Each zone was a nice discovery. The tanks were clean, well-maintained and the glass clear which allowed good views of the lively aquatic life. For an extra 5 Euros each, we joined a tour of the backstage areas. It included more in-depth explanations of food preparation, medical treatments and we saw how Zebra sharks were fed. The tour was unrushed and our knowledgeable guide provided lots of fun facts. The reptiles and amphibians area was small but fun as we got closeups of the insects and reptiles. Another worthy mention is the 4D motion ride and tumble to the bottom of the ocean. Although it lasted merely a few minutes but it was fun with the shaking floors and the video which created sense of adventure and danger from a make-believe giant squid attack. The heritage area on the top floor was informative with photos and writeups. There is also a small theatre screen short clips. You won't miss much here if you decide to skip. WHEN TO VISIT: At close to noon on a weekend, the venue was packed especially at the ticketing counter and at the start of the exhibits. The crowd thinned around 3pm.

Really cute must see attraction in Buggiba. We travelled there from Valetta by bus and it takes between 45mins and 1hr20min, depending which bus you take. You can grabb either 31, 45 or 48 from Valetta bay B5. If you book the tickets online they are cheaper and they are valid for up to 6 months from the date of purchase. Tickets are not dated, so you can decided what day you want to go there, however its one time entry. They are open from 10am to 8pm every day. They do little talks (in English) for each departments at set times. Its best to have a look at their website. You can get some family photos taken by the staff. There is a souvenir shop at the end of your journey. When you visit, pay attention to little screens with some info next to the tanks as you can find a lot of unusual stories. We found the cutest thing ever there, its albino stingray (see video) and the story behind it. I would recommend this place for everyone to visit. Staff is friendly and helpful. You can also find one restaurant inside the aquarium, one on aside and one patisserie outside next to the children playground.
